Output d3c7cfa20e6cda10772369c8cb8a060610b60e8a9bb4e1d869cdc1feecf94fe6:0

value
320926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5250e230be4d60cc0438c8a4c316c82d2623bc4c OP_EQUAL
address
39CGEALkddou3BssmYG1GG34WB9GCnsaLv
transaction
d3c7cfa20e6cda10772369c8cb8a060610b60e8a9bb4e1d869cdc1feecf94fe6
confirmations
265739
spent
true